Long-Term Unemployment Benefits For Unemployed Idahoans To Expire Soon
(AP) – The state Department of Labor says long-term unemployment benefits in Idaho will expire after Dec. 31, though some jobless workers will be cut off sooner depending on when they started receiving the federal assistance. Agency spokesman Bob Fick says the jobless benefits are being scaled back because Idaho’s jobless rate is improving and a new federal law is phasing out emergency assistance
TF City Council To Consider Annexation Of Chobani Property
With the construction of the Chobani yogurt factory well under way, the Twin Falls City Council will consider a proposal tonight to annex the property on which the new facility is being built. Right now the property is still outside the city limits and therefore the city of Twin Falls cannot collect city taxes.
Magic Valley Lays Hero To Rest
Saturday afternoon, family, friends and a community remembered Army Staff Sergeant Daniel Brown, a Jerome soldier killed by enemy explosives in Afghanistan two weeks ago. Over a thousand people gathered with them for his funeral service at the College of Southern Idaho in Twin Falls. Brown was killed 10 months into deployment.

Twin Falls Woman Charged With Stealing From Bank
A Twin Falls woman has been charged with one count of grand theft after being accused of stealing money while employed as a teller at a Wells Fargo Bank Branch. 20 year old Krystyn Whittemore was arraigned yesterday. Twin Falls police began investigating the case last month after receiving information about the alleged thefts.

Gov. Otter Signs Public School Funding Bill
(AP) – Idaho Gov. “Butch” Otter has signed a 2013 funding plan for public schools that includes funds for the state’s new education reforms, including merit pay bonuses and laptops. The budget includes $1.27 billion in state general funding, a $56 million bump over the current fiscal year. Bruce Willis Says He Might Give Away Soldier Mountain To Non-Profit
(AP) – Bruce Willis says he’s willing to give away his central Idaho ski resort to a nonprofit organization.The action star has already put his lavish home in nearby Hailey on the market, as well as the local bar he owns, for a combined $19 million.
Sneezing? Doctors Say Allergy Season Arrived Early
If you a re doing a lot of sniffling and sneezing you are not alone? It might be because of allergy season. It is here and this year it came a little early. Dr. Stephen Fritz, an allergist, says because of our mild winter allergy season hit a few weeks early.
